Many people are exploring cannabis as another option for pain relief. Cannabis is a plant that has hundreds of substances called cannabinoids and terpenes that can affect the body’s endocannabinoid system (ECS). The two most well-known cannabinoids in cannabis are t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and cannabidiol (CBD). THC is the psychoactive component that causes the “high” feeling associated with cannabis use. Both THC and CBD can help relieve pain by affecting the ECS and changing how pain signals are perceived in the brain and spinal cord. However, they may have different effects depending on the kind and origin of pain.

For instance, THC may be more helpful for neuropathic pain (pain caused by nerve problems or injury), while CBD may be more helpful for inflammatory pain (pain caused by tissue injury or infection). Therefore, finding the best cannabis strain for pain relief depends on several factors, such as the kind of pain, the wanted effects, the tolerance level, and the personal choice of the user. Indica strains are generally more soothing, sedating, and body-oriented. They may be more fitting for chronic pain, muscle spasms, insomnia, or stress. Some examples of indica strains for pain relief are Afghan Kush1, Blueberry2, and Northern Lights3.

Sativa strains are typically more stimulating, uplifting, and mind-focused. They may be more suitable for acute pain, migraines, depression, or fatigue.
